AI Generated Summary
AI-generated. Powered by real user reviews.
  • Users report that Appcelerator offers a strong multi-language support feature, allowing developers to work with various programming languages seamlessly, while Android Studio is noted for its robust integration with Java and Kotlin, which some users find limiting for cross-platform development.
  • Reviewers mention that Appcelerator's ease of use is enhanced by its intuitive interface, making it accessible for small businesses, whereas Android Studio, despite its higher ease of use rating, can be overwhelming for beginners due to its extensive features and options.
  • G2 users highlight that Appcelerator's customization options are highly praised, allowing for tailored app development, while Android Studio's customization is often seen as more complex, requiring a deeper understanding of the platform to fully utilize its capabilities.
  • Users on G2 report that Appcelerator's help guides are user-friendly and provide clear instructions, which is beneficial for new users, while Android Studio's documentation, although comprehensive, can sometimes be difficult to navigate for those unfamiliar with the platform.
  • Reviewers say that Appcelerator's patching and updates are generally smooth and less disruptive, which is a significant advantage for small businesses looking to maintain operational continuity, while Android Studio users have reported occasional issues with update processes that can lead to temporary disruptions.
  • Users say that the quality of support for Appcelerator is a common area of concern, with many feeling that it falls short compared to Android Studio, which is frequently praised for its responsive and helpful support team, contributing to a better overall user experience.
